Match Preview: What to Expect
The Liverpool vs Bournemouth match promises to be an exciting encounter. Liverpool, known for their attacking prowess and high-pressing game, will likely dominate possession and create numerous scoring opportunities. Their front three, led by Mohamed Salah, will be looking to exploit any weaknesses in the Bournemouth defense. Expect them to play with intensity and try to overwhelm Bournemouth from the start. However, they need to be wary of Bournemouth's counter-attacking threat, as the Cherries have players who can quickly transition from defense to attack.
Bournemouth, on the other hand, will probably adopt a more cautious approach, focusing on defensive solidity and quick counter-attacks. Their midfielders will need to be disciplined and organized to stifle Liverpool's creative players. Upfront, they will rely on their pace and directness to trouble the Liverpool defense. Set-pieces could also be a key weapon for Bournemouth, as they have players who are good in the air. To get a positive result, Bournemouth needs to be clinical in front of goal and defend resolutely as a team.
Considering both teams' strengths and weaknesses, the match could be a tactical battle with Liverpool dictating the tempo and Bournemouth looking to hit on the break. Key match-ups, such as Salah vs. Kelly and Thiago vs. Brooks, could determine the outcome. The midfield battle will be crucial, as the team that wins the midfield will likely control the game. Also, the goalkeepers will need to be at their best, as both teams have the firepower to create plenty of chances.
